Then, can you use regular tattoo ink for permanent makeup?

Due to the biological structure of the face, the sensitivity of the skin and desired results, it is paramount that permanent makeup artists don’t use regular tattoo ink for permanent makeupthey should only use permanent makeup pigments in their treatments!

What lasts longer Microblading or tattoo?

Microblading eyebrows lasts 1 to 2 years. Eyebrow tattoos last forever. Regular eyebrow tattoos last a lifetime, but with microblading, ink is not placed as deep underneath the skin. … Over time, the ink will fade significantly compared to an eyebrow tattoo.

Can you get an MRI if you have permanent makeup?

There have been reports of people with tattoos or permanent makeup who experienced swelling or burning in the affected areas when they underwent magnetic resonance imaging (MRI). … Instead of avoiding an MRI, individuals who have tattoos or permanent makeup should inform the radiologist or radiologic technologist.

Does Lip Blush tattoo make your lips bigger?

What is lip blushing? Lip blushing is a form of semi-permanent cosmetic tattoo that enhances the lips‘ natural tint and shape, giving them a boost and a glossy touch. It’s designed to define and outline your lips, not to actually make them fuller. It gives the illusion that they’re fuller, but in a very natural way.

How bad do lip tattoos hurt?

Expect pain as well as some bleeding during the process. You might experience more pain with a lip tattoo compared with other areas of the body, such as an arm or leg tattoo. It can take about two weeks for a new tattoo to heal, so be sure you understand all aftercare techniques before leaving the studio.
